King University, established in 1867 in Bristol, Tennessee, is a Christian academic community affiliated with the Presbyterian Church. It offers over 90 majors, minors, pre-professional degrees, and concentrations through its five academic schools.

Step-by-Step Guide to Admission Requirements at King University

Completed Application Form
Applicants must submit a completed online application form through the university’s admissions portal.

High School Diploma or Equivalent
Applicants must have a high school diploma or its equivalent (e.g., GED) from an accredited institution.

Official High School Transcripts
Applicants must submit official transcripts from all high schools attended, including grades, courses, and graduation status.

Minimum GPA
Most Bachelor’s programs require a minimum GPA, usually around 2.5–3.0, though it may vary by program.

Letters of Recommendation
Applicants are typically required to submit one or more letters of recommendation, often from high school teachers or counselors.

Standardized Test Scores
Many programs require SAT or ACT scores, though some may waive this requirement based on GPA or other factors.

Personal Statement or Essay
A personal statement or essay outlining the applicant's academic and career goals, as well as their reasons for choosing King University.

Resume (Optional)
While not always required, some applicants may submit a resume to highlight extracurricular activities, volunteer work, or any relevant work experience.

English Language Proficiency
For international students, proof of English proficiency is required, usually through TOEFL or IELTS scores.

Application Fee
A non-refundable application fee is required to process the application, though fee waivers may be available in certain circumstances.

Specific requirements may vary depending on the program or department. It's recommended to visit the official King University website or contact the admissions office for exact details.
